Drone reveals are actually enjoyable to observe, and most of them go off utterly safely. But it surely’s the exceptions that are inclined to make the information — and there may be an occasional information story round a drone present gone flawed.
For some drone present firms, fast progress in demand has created stress to scale up rapidly — with out in some instances equal scale in security procedures. Whereas superior software program like Drone Present Software program (DSS) gives sturdy security options to foretell or forestall points, expertise alone isn’t sufficient. Many further components—from planning oversights to environmental circumstances akin to water high quality, air high quality, and climate, which regularly range throughout geographic places — can nonetheless compromise a present.
On the whole, most points stem from an general lack of preparation — and sometimes it’s human error somewhat than tech error. The human components concerned in planning and organizing the present are essential. Complete planning, together with scheduling adequate preparation time, setting clear duties for every group member and making certain that every one security protocols are adopted, is important to attenuate these dangers.
So what does that imply in observe? Listed here are six of the commonest errors that may result in failures—and the right way to keep away from them.


1. Not correctly researching the launch location
Failing to evaluate the atmosphere earlier than the present may end up in critical problems. Consider components like wind circumstances, interference from close by communication indicators, and bodily obstacles to keep away from mid-show failures.
✔ What to do: Go to the positioning upfront, ideally in particular person. Whereas there, right here are some things it’s best to do:
- Measure wind pace with an anemometer.
- Examine International Navigation Satellite tv for pc System (GNSS) satellite tv for pc availability (not less than 13 satellites required)
- Examine the bottom floor for hazards by conducting visible inspections and capturing photographs or movies.
- Guarantee correct geofencing is in place.
2. Skipping in-office testing earlier than the present
Testing from the consolation of your individual workplace is vital to recognizing technical or operational points earlier than they turn out to be full-blown issues throughout a stay efficiency on the scene.
Utilizing software program options like DSS can assist confirm drone animation accuracy through the design section. DSS’s built-in simulator can be useful in “testing” earlier than you even get to the actual location.
✔ What to do: If you happen to use a software program like DSS, use the DSS Blender plug-in and Fleet Simulator for pre-flight animation testing. Conduct takeoff exams to confirm positioning and calibrate the compass if wanted. Repeat exams till all drones full the take a look at procedures with out errors.
3. Speeding on-site setup
A rushed setup will increase the probability of essential errors being missed. With out correct time for ultimate checks, important security measures is perhaps missed, resulting in avoidable failures.
Earlier than the present, make sure the drones’ settings, akin to geofencing and GNSS satellite tv for pc connectivity, are accurately configured.
Moreover, allocate ample setup time. In fact, setup time varies by your present’s distinctive circumstances. However on common, a fleet of 100 drones requires two to a few hours of setup.
✔ What to do: Guarantee a well-organized present structure, together with designated takeoff zones, restricted employees areas, and safe spectator zones. If doable, carry out dry runs of on-site setup on a earlier day so that everybody is aware of what precisely needs to be executed and the way. This could additionally assist the group decide precisely how a lot setup time is required.
4. Not conducting a full take a look at run
Even when drones are flown efficiently in smaller, much less advanced exams, skipping a full-scale rehearsal beneath actual present circumstances can result in surprising issues. These would possibly embrace points with positioning, flight stability, or communication between drones, which could not have been detected throughout smaller trials.
Moreover, technical features akin to battery life, GPS connectivity and software program configuration can current challenges that go unnoticed with out correct testing. To keep away from this, carry out a number of dry runs – beginning with a easy take-off take a look at to a full take a look at rehearsal with the entire fleet, making certain that every one drones are synchronized and function as anticipated.
✔ What to do: Start with a small-scale rehearsal utilizing 4 to six drones. If doable, ultimate circumstances would mean you can full a full-scale take a look at replicating actual present circumstances.
Whether or not you do a smaller rehearsal or full dry run, affirm that altitude, distance and pace constraints match present necessities to stop mid-air collisions.
5. Not double-checking security features
Neglecting safety-critical components will increase the danger of malfunctions or accidents. Even skilled groups could make human errors with no structured security test. ‘Double down on security’ is a core precept in aviation.
The most effective drone present software program consists of an impartial management interface that enables a second operator to ship emergency instructions to particular person drones or the entire fleet, which DSS calls Redbutton.
✔ What to do: Assign a devoted Redbutton operator, measure wind pace precisely, and implement polygon and laborious fence settings to attenuate dangers. Guarantee a second particular person verifies every show-critical security component as a part of a structured double-check course of.
6. Not utilizing an in depth guidelines
A structured guidelines is the spine of a clean operation. Skipping guidelines steps can result in surprising points, from battery failures to GPS connection losses. Having a second particular person confirm every safety-critical component, akin to wind pace limits, battery checks, and emergency shutdown procedures, additional reduces the danger of failure.
✔ What to do: Make the most of the built-in guidelines inside Drone Present Software program. This covers essential security parameters akin to wind pace limits (5-6 m/s max), required GNSS satellites (minimal 13), security distances, and emergency shutdown procedures. The guidelines can be personalized to suit particular venture wants.
